Description

The ERCC6 gene encodes a protein responsible for repairing DNA damaged by oxidative stress, gamma radiation, UV rays and X-rays. The protein is involved in transcription-coupled nucleotide excision repair, wherein it is required for the recruitment of numerous repair proteins to form the transcription-coupled repair complex. Mutations in the ERCC6 gene have been associated with a severe subset of Cockayne syndrome.
